Miso Pasta
A creamy and savory pasta dish that combines white miso with butter and parmesan for a quick and satisfying meal.

Ingredients
12
oz
pasta
spaghetti or your favorite pasta
0.25
cup
butter
1
small
shallot
finely minced
1
tbsp
garlic
minced
0.25
cup
white miso paste
1
cup
freshly grated parmesan cheese
1
tsp
black pepper
freshly ground
0.25
tsp
salt
1.25
cups
reserved pasta cooking water
Instructions
Bring a large pot of salted water to a boil and cook the pasta according to package instructions, reserving 1 ¼ cups of pasta water before draining.
Melt butter in a sauté pan over medium heat. Add minced shallot and garlic, cooking for 3 to 5 minutes until softened and fragrant.
Stir in the white miso paste, cooking for another minute to enhance its flavor.
Whisk in parmesan cheese, salt, black pepper, and reserved pasta water until the cheese melts and the sauce is creamy.
Toss the cooked pasta with the sauce until fully coated. Serve immediately with extra parmesan and red pepper flakes if desired.

Notes
Store leftovers in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to 2 days. Reheat with a splash of water to restore creaminess.
